Skip to content

Instantly share code, notes, and snippets.

@Jerga99
Last active July 11, 2018 08:44
Show Gist options
  • Star 0 You must be signed in to star a gist
  • Fork 0 You must be signed in to fork a gist
  • Save Jerga99/aae797046d779592c72fc48560bba037 to your computer and use it in GitHub Desktop.
Save Jerga99/aae797046d779592c72fc48560bba037 to your computer and use it in GitHub Desktop.
<form #registerForm="ngForm">
<div class="form-group">
<label for="username">Username</label>
<input [(ngModel)]="formData.username"
#username="ngModel"
name="username"
type="text"
class="form-control"
id="username"
required>
<div *ngIf="username.invalid && (username.dirty || username.touched)"
class="alert alert-danger">
<div *ngIf="username.errors.required">
Username is required.
</div>
</div>
</div>
<div class="form-group">
<label for="email">Email</label>
<input [(ngModel)]="formData.email"
name="email"
type="email"
class="form-control"
id="email"
required>
</div>
<div class="form-group">
<label for="password">Password</label>
<input [(ngModel)]="formData.password"
name="password"
type="password"
class="form-control"
id="password"
required>
</div>
<div class="form-group">
<label for="passwordConfirmation">Confirm Password</label>
<input [(ngModel)]="formData.passwordConfirmation"
name="passwordConfirmation"
type="password"
class="form-control"
id="passwordConfirmation"
required>
</div>
<button [disabled]="!registerForm.form.valid" (click)="register()" type="submit" class="btn btn-bwm">Submit</button>
</form>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ment